Vocabularies¶
Vocabularies are utilities containing a list of values grouped by interest or different Plone features.
For example, plone.app.vocabularies.ReallyUserFriendlyTypes
will return all the content types registered in Plone.
The vocabularies return a list of objects with the items title
and token
.
Note
These docs are generated by code tests, therefore you will see some ‘test’ contenttypes appear here.
Get all vocabularies¶
To retrieve a list of all the available vocabularies, send a GET request to the @vocabularies endpoint:
GET /plone/@vocabularies HTTP/1.1
Accept: application/json
Authorization: Basic YWRtaW46c2VjcmV0
curl -i http://nohost/plone/@vocabularies -H 'Accept: application/json' --user admin:secret
http http://nohost/plone/@vocabularies Accept:application/json -a admin:secret
requests.get('http://nohost/plone/@vocabularies', headers={
'Accept': 'application/json',
}, auth=('admin', 'secret'))
The response will include a list with the URL (@id
) the dotted names (title
) of all the available vocabularies in Plone:
HTTP/1.1 200 OK
Content-Type: application/json

Get a vocabulary¶
To get a particular vocabulary, use the @vocabularies
endpoint with the name of the vocabulary, e.g. /plone/@vocabularies/plone.app.vocabularies.ReallyUserFriendlyTypes
.
The endpoint can be used with the site root and content objects.
GET /plone/@vocabularies/plone.app.vocabularies.ReallyUserFriendlyTypes HTTP/1.1
Accept: application/json
Authorization: Basic YWRtaW46c2VjcmV0
curl -i http://nohost/plone/@vocabularies/plone.app.vocabularies.ReallyUserFriendlyTypes -H 'Accept: application/json' --user admin:secret
http http://nohost/plone/@vocabularies/plone.app.vocabularies.ReallyUserFriendlyTypes Accept:application/json -a admin:secret
requests.get('http://nohost/plone/@vocabularies/plone.app.vocabularies.ReallyUserFriendlyTypes', headers={
'Accept': 'application/json',
}, auth=('admin', 'secret'))
The server will respond with a list of terms. The title is purely for display purposes. The token is what should be sent to the server to retrieve the value of the term.
Note
Vocabulary terms will be batched if the size of the resultset exceeds the batch size. See Batching for more details on how to work with batched results.
HTTP/1.1 200 OK
Content-Type: application/json

Filter Vocabularies¶
Vocabulary terms can be filtered using the title
or token
parameter.
Use the title
paramenter to filter vocabulary terms by title.
E.g. search for all terms that contain the string doc
in the title:
GET /plone/@vocabularies/plone.app.vocabularies.ReallyUserFriendlyTypes?title=doc HTTP/1.1
Accept: application/json
Authorization: Basic YWRtaW46c2VjcmV0
curl -i 'http://nohost/plone/@vocabularies/plone.app.vocabularies.ReallyUserFriendlyTypes?title=doc' -H 'Accept: application/json' --user admin:secret
http 'http://nohost/plone/@vocabularies/plone.app.vocabularies.ReallyUserFriendlyTypes?title=doc' Accept:application/json -a admin:secret
requests.get('http://nohost/plone/@vocabularies/plone.app.vocabularies.ReallyUserFriendlyTypes?title=doc', headers={
'Accept': 'application/json',
}, auth=('admin', 'secret'))
HTTP/1.1 200 OK
Content-Type: application/json

Use the token
paramenter to filter vocabulary terms by token.
This is useful in case that you have the token and you need to retrieve the title
.
E.g. search the term doc
in the token:
GET /plone/@vocabularies/plone.app.vocabularies.ReallyUserFriendlyTypes?token=Document HTTP/1.1
Accept: application/json
Authorization: Basic YWRtaW46c2VjcmV0
curl -i 'http://nohost/plone/@vocabularies/plone.app.vocabularies.ReallyUserFriendlyTypes?token=Document' -H 'Accept: application/json' --user admin:secret
http 'http://nohost/plone/@vocabularies/plone.app.vocabularies.ReallyUserFriendlyTypes?token=Document' Accept:application/json -a admin:secret
requests.get('http://nohost/plone/@vocabularies/plone.app.vocabularies.ReallyUserFriendlyTypes?token=Document', headers={
'Accept': 'application/json',
}, auth=('admin', 'secret'))
HTTP/1.1 200 OK
Content-Type: application/json

Note
You must not filter by title and token at the same time. The API returns a 400 response code if you do so.
